Salma Hayek..............Salma Valgarma Hayek Jimenez better known by her married name Salma Hayek Pinault is a Mexican-American actress born to Spanish and Lebanese parents. She is from a prestigious Mexican Roman Catholic family. Hayek's parents are opera singer Diana Jimenez Medina, and Sami Hayek Dominguez. The U.S. she went to the Academy of the Sacred Heart to study when she was 12. At the age of a girl who was influenced by Willy Wonka & the Chocolate Factory to pursue a career as an actor. When she completed her studies at Mexico City's Universidad Iberoamericana she decided to pursue a career in film. Hayek was a star in Mexico when she was crowned her role as the titular character in the Mexican TV series Teresa in 1989. Following that, she moved into Los Angeles California and studied acting at Stella Adler. Through the latter half of 1990, she only had brief appearances as a hotmaid as in Dream On Street Justice. In 1993, she appeared in The Sinbad Show. Her one and only appearance for Mi Vida Loca was a character. The actress played Quedate Aqui in the 1995 movie Desperado with Antonio Banderas. The actress was in Matthew Perry's Fools Rush In (1997) as well as Will Smith's Wild Wild West (1998) as well as Kevin Smith's Dogma (1998). In the past, she won an ALMA award for the best actress in a short film and starred in Summer blockbuster Wild Wild West. Ventanarosa's production company produced the Mexican film, No One Writes The Colonel (1999) and Mexico presented as its official Oscar entry into the category of best foreign film for the Cannes Film Festival. The new millennium began with her preparations for her dream role in Frida who was the Mexican iconic character she had always wanted to play after moving to Hollywood. She starred in Once Upon a Time in Mexico in 2003. She reprised the role she played in Desperado. In March 2007, she revealed her pregnancy and confirmed her marriage to French billionaire Francois-Henri Pinault. Valentina paloma pinault, her daughter, was born in September. Hayek was Director of the executive office at Ugly Betty between 2006 and the year 2010. Hayek appeared on a series of specials as Sofia Reyes, for which she received a nomination at the Primetime Emmy Awards 59th. Her hilarious acting skills were showcased in the show Grown-Ups (2010), where she starred alongside Adam Sandler. The actress was in 2011 on the animated Puss In Boots. Hayek was also in Some Kind of Beautiful and Everly both in 2014. She played Queen of Longtrellis in Tale of Tales (2015).
